Abstract
The application discloses kitchen waste oil recovery refines machine, it includes bottom framework, main tank body, oil collecting system and oil collecting groove, set up with the main tank body on the bottom framework, oil collecting system sets up on the main tank body, the oil collecting groove sets up one side of oil collecting system, oil collecting system is including rotating the oil absorption disc that dips in oil water mixture and be used for scraping the oil collecting scraper of oil absorption disc surface adhesion oil down, the oil collecting scraper with oil absorption disc contact. The present application has the effect of reducing the volume of the oil collection system.

Detailed Description
The present application is described in further detail below in conjunction with figures 1-3.
The embodiment of the application discloses a kitchen waste oil recovery refiners.
Referring to fig. 1 and 2, including bottom framework 1, main tank body 2, oil collecting system 3 and oil collecting groove 4, main tank body 2 is placed in the upside of bottom framework 1, and oil collecting system 3 and oil collecting groove 4 set up in the upside of main tank body 2, and oil collecting groove 4 is located one side of oil collecting system 3, and the upside bolted connection of main tank body 2 has flip door 14, and one side bolted connection of flip door 14 has the spring handle, and one side bolted connection of main tank body 2 has electric cabinet 15.
The inside of main tank body 2 has evenly arranged a plurality of heating rods 12, and the heating rod 12 heats in order to guarantee that the oil-water mixture in the main tank body 2 is in liquid state, and one side bolted connection of main tank body 2 has temperature sensor 13, and temperature sensor 13 feeds back the temperature of oil-water mixture to electric cabinet 15 in real time, and electric cabinet 15 adjusts the opening or closing of heating rod 12 heating through the information of feedback, in proper order with the stability of oil-water mixture temperature.
The middle of the upper side of the main box body 2 is provided with a rotating assembly 16, the rotating assembly 16 comprises a driving device 17, a rotating rod 18, bearings and bearing seats 19, the bearing seats 19 are respectively connected to two sides of the upper side of the main box body 2 through bolts, the bearings are placed in the bearing seats 19, one end of each rotating rod 18 is inserted into and connected with the corresponding bearing seat 19, and the other end of each rotating rod 18 penetrates through the other bearing seat 19 to be connected with the driving device 17.
The oil collecting system 3 comprises an oil absorbing disc 5 and oil collecting scraping plates 6, the oil absorbing disc 5 is connected to the surface of a rotating rod 18 through bolts, and rotates along with the rotation of the rotating rod 18, the oil absorbing disc 5 is in contact with an oil-water mixture, the oil absorbing disc 5 absorbs oil in the oil-water mixture, the oil collecting groove 4 comprises a first oil collecting groove 20 and a second oil collecting groove 21, the first oil collecting groove 20 is located below the oil collecting scraping plates 6, the oil collecting scraping plates 6 are respectively welded on two sides of the first oil collecting groove 20, the two oil collecting scraping plates 6 are respectively in contact with two sides of the oil absorbing disc 5, the oil collecting scraping plates 6 scrape oil adhering to the surface of the oil absorbing disc 5, the second oil collecting groove 21 is located at the end portion of the first oil collecting groove 20, and scraped oil drips to the first oil collecting groove 20 along the edge of the oil collecting scraping plates 6, and flows out along with the first oil collecting groove 20 and the second oil collecting groove 21.
One side of the main body box is provided with a feed inlet 7, an oil-water mixture to be treated enters the main box body 2 through the feed inlet 7, one end of the second oil collecting groove 21 is connected with an oil outlet 8, and scraped oil is collected through the oil outlet 8.
The inside bolted connection of main tank body 2 has liquid level controller 9, liquid level controller 9 includes liquid level control floater 22, and liquid level control floater 22 floats in the inside of main tank, and liquid level controller 9 obtains the height that has the water mixture in the main tank body 2 through liquid level control floater 22, and then the feed inlet 7 is closed to feedback electric cabinet 15.
Referring to fig. 2 and 3, one side of the main casing 2 is penetrated through and connected with a tap water inlet 10, a user introduces tap water through the tap water inlet 10, and then washes the main casing 2, and a cleaning spray gun 11 is disposed at one side of the main casing 2, the cleaning spray gun 11 being used for spraying the outside of the cleaning casing and the inside of the main casing 2.
One side of the lower part of the main box body 2 is provided with an emptying port, and the emptying port is sleeved with an emptying ball valve 23, so that the emptying ball valve is convenient for emptying all liquid in the main box body 2.
Further, according to the present embodiment, the oil collecting scraper 6 contacts the oil suction disc 5, and the oil collecting scraper 6 radially intersects the horizontal plane, so that the scraped oil flows in the downward direction of the oil collecting scraper 6 on the oil collecting scraper 6, and the rear oil flows into the first oil collecting groove 20 by gravity.
Further, according to the present embodiment, the first oil sump 20 is inclined toward the end near the second oil sump 21, and the second oil sump 21 is inclined toward the oil outlet 8.
Further, according to the present embodiment, the heating rod 12 is located close to the oil suction disc 5, so that the heating effect of the oil-water mixture near the oil suction disc 5 is best, and the oil-water mixture is ensured to be kept in a liquid state.
The embodiment of the application discloses a kitchen waste oil recovery refiners' implementation principle is: the oil-water mixture to be treated enters the main box body 2 through the feed inlet 7, the heating rod 12 and the temperature sensor 13 maintain the oil-water mixture in liquid, the oil-water mixture is absorbed by the oil absorption disc 5, the absorbed oil is brought to the oil collecting scraping plate 6 by the rotation of the oil absorption disc 5, the oil is scraped by the oil collecting scraping plate 6, and the scraped oil flows to the oil outlet 8 along with the first oil collecting groove 20 and the second oil collecting groove 21.
